Type
ORACLE
Validation date
2024-07-22 08:34: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0195,
    "usd": 0.02122
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001E360C8167BBA448683CEB32A143FF22F406C023CC814D2C5E925184419EA7B1E

Previous signature

C92AC1FB2C029E2015CCC76C9D3E6D69FB6F3A09FAD289D7AE05410EF3530AF10F2A34D4E0D37853201D74045D865E60F3A559D7E1FF77798DD0B830EC954508

Origin signature

3045022100C415B0F31F3FB8D0346AEE50EB8B84DE0E9F7C5C508E71FF95C842E187C17D4302205C9811BFE5AE731B548CC54E8068E41CAA89684789FDC991F3697EE80A2783D4

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

0038713B301C0EF1B8286E1ACE7B21026769B0618FB8F883BAAE144A7018F77C1C

Coordinator signature

8A2C3E1E6DDB965814BBF34886214A59FB618D2B4855B00F7DC9109B97DBC104ED408088D7EC74060B48E1F20ABE2EA1E25870C60561F25AC1E73F53558A1C05

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

E1632DE85665C862D431A758BE12FCFB226298AF41D73BDFF8E687C2F1E1FCC3BEFB80D332EA966CB636458FB5986A976472F529374E0EED5263B3BA5B726F0E

Validator #2 public key

000177BA744AC778DC2D51A1B7C622E7AC4BD1E1AA8DA2D0FCE71BAAB7DAD0E020E0

Validator #2 signature

91C954940097A2F4F55467A06591929880D3C01C3FBE465092B6E2FFDBAA8DB7B4125B6AA2E3BA4ED787A382B29DF1A77E10B876A6AB9F40BEE44F1D3341650F